Peru’s Sacred Valley: Nature and Culture Combined

Introduction

The Sacred Valley of the Incas, nestled amidst the breathtaking Andes Mountains, is a region of unparalleled beauty and historical significance. This fertile valley, located just north of Cusco, Peru, was once the heartland of the Inca Empire and remains a treasure trove of archaeological wonders, stunning landscapes, and vibrant culture. In this article, we will explore the captivating beauty and rich history of the Sacred Valley.

A Journey Through Time

The Sacred Valley is home to numerous Inca ruins, each offering a glimpse into the ancient civilization that once thrived in this region.

  • Machu Picchu: The crown jewel of the Sacred Valley, Machu Picchu is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the most iconic archaeological sites in the world. Perched high above the Urubamba River, this ancient Inca citadel offers breathtaking views and a glimpse into the advanced engineering and architectural skills of the Inca people.
  • Pisac: This charming town is known for its colorful markets, where visitors can purchase handmade textiles, ceramics, and other local crafts. Pisac also has impressive Inca ruins, including a fortress and agricultural terraces.
  • Ollantaytambo: This ancient Inca fortress is located along the Urubamba River and offers stunning views of the surrounding mountains. The fortress was once a strategic military outpost and a place of worship.
  • Moray: Moray is a unique archaeological site featuring a series of circular agricultural terraces that were used for agricultural experimentation. The terraces were designed to create different microclimates, allowing the Inca people to grow a variety of crops.

Natural Beauty

The Sacred Valley is blessed with stunning natural beauty, including mountains, rivers, and lush valleys.

  • Urubamba River: The Urubamba River flows through the heart of the Sacred Valley, offering opportunities for rafting, kayaking, and fishing.
  • Mountains: The surrounding mountains provide breathtaking scenery and opportunities for hiking and trekking. The Cordillera Vilcabamba, a mountain range that borders the Sacred Valley, is home to several peaks over 6,000 meters (19,685 feet).
  • Salineras de Maras: These salt pans, located near the town of Maras, are a fascinating sight. The salt pans are terraced into the hillside, creating a colorful and unique landscape.

Cultural Experiences

The Sacred Valley is home to a rich and vibrant culture, with traditions that have been passed down through generations. Visitors can experience the local culture by attending festivals, visiting traditional villages, and learning about ancient customs.

  • Local Markets: The markets in the Sacred Valley offer a wide variety of local products, including textiles, handicrafts, and fresh produce.
  • Traditional Festivals: The Sacred Valley celebrates numerous festivals throughout the year, including the Inti Raymi, the Inca Festival of the Sun.
  • Community-Based Tourism: Support local communities by participating in community-based tourism initiatives, such as homestays and cultural exchanges.

Planning Your Trip

When planning a trip to the Sacred Valley, consider the following:

  • Best Time to Visit: The dry season, from May to September, is the best time to visit the Sacred Valley, as the weather is pleasant and the trails are less crowded.
  • Accommodation: The Sacred Valley offers a wide range of accommodation options, from budget-friendly hostels to luxury hotels.
  • Transportation: The most convenient way to get around the Sacred Valley is by car or bus.
  • Altitude Sickness: The Sacred Valley is located at a high altitude, so it’s important to acclimatize gradually to avoid altitude sickness.
